      A rollicking, bawdy collection of 50 fairy tales told by 10 storytellers over five days follows the compilation efforts of 17th-century Italian poet Giambattista Basile and traces the experiences of a cursed princess who would win back her betrothed.

    • Eine Gruppe von Reisenden verbringt eine Nacht im sagenumwobenen, von Raeubern durchstreiften Spessart. Um ihre Angst zu vertreiben, erzaehlen sie sich Geschichten - die Sage vom Hirschgulden, Das kalte Herz, Saids Schicksale und Die Hoehle von Steenfoll. Diese spannungsgeladenen Maerchen besitzen einen besonderen Reiz, der in dem fabelhaften Zauber liegt, den sie in das gewoehnliche Menschenleben mischen.

    • Merry, dark or magical, these classic tales never fail to inspire and enthral. From the land of fantastical castles, vast lakes and deep forests, the Brothers Grimm collected a treasury of entrancing folk and fairy stories full of giants and dwarfs, witches and princesses, magic beasts and cunning boys. From favourites such as The Frog-Prince and Hansel and Gretel to the delights of Ashputtel or Old Sultan, all are vivid with timeless mystery.

      The story follows Tartarin, a character with an exaggerated sense of heroism, as he embarks on humorous adventures in the picturesque landscapes of Provence. Through satire and comedy, the novel cleverly critiques French society's quirks and idiosyncrasies. Daudet's lighthearted narrative explores themes of heroism, identity, and the human spirit, providing a joyful and imaginative escape for readers. With its vivid portrayal of Southern France and engaging storytelling, the book delivers a delightful blend of adventure and humor.
